**Finance Review Summary — Loyalty Overhaul**

The Orchard Points programme will be replaced by a tiered scheme in Q2. Accrual costs fall from 2.1% to 1.6% of eligible revenue, while redemption flexibility improves for top-tier members. Branch-level breakage assumptions have been revised downward. Expected net annual saving is meaningful. Context for the change appears below.

internal memo for kawip-hadug: Headcount on the Wenwyn team goes from 7 to 140 by the end of January. Gross margin on Wenwyn came in at 20 percent against a plan of 15 percent.

# Break-Glass: Deep-Link Routing (Pocketlark)

Hey support folks — if the Pocketlark mobile deep-link router starts sending everyone to the wrong screen and nobody from the Routes team is around, you can use break-glass access to flip the fallback map yourself. Go easy: it bypasses review, so only do this during a real outage, and ping the on-call channel right after. To unlock the break-glass console, enter the recovery passphrase shown below.

strongbox words: sorir-belvan-rusix-ulays-ralmir-praix-eliir-tamax-praael-druael-julir-tamius-jorir

Fan-out backpressure for the Quillet notifier: when the queue depth crosses the soft limit, the dispatcher sheds low-priority pushes and batches the rest at 500ms intervals. Reviewer should confirm the shed counter is exported and that retries respect the jitter window. Once merged, the release artifact gets re-signed by the pipeline, which expects the deploy key shown below.

deploy key for bawep-yawif: bky6_GQhaSt

### Spreadsheet exports and memory

Heads up: the Cobbleworth export service builds spreadsheets fully in memory, so a big tenant pulling 200k rows can spike a worker past 2 GB. We cap exports at 50k rows per sheet and stream anything larger through the chunked path — don't "fix" that, it's load-bearing. If you see OOM kills in the exporter pods, check for someone bypassing the cap via the admin flag. To poke the internal metrics endpoint while debugging, use the key below.

gateway credential: kto23_LX9A4ys6i4nzHtpOLNLodKK